Inventory Write-Down (Managers Only)

A write-down of the Drexel-line finished goods was booked in September following the obsolescence review. Affected stock: legacy housings at the Westholm warehouse. Impact: reduction in gross margin of roughly one point for the quarter. Remaining units will be scrapped or sold at salvage. No restatement required. The board should note the confidential planning context below.

board note of bawep-tajef: Queniusek Systems plans to raise the Quenvan list price by 53.1 percent in March. The pricing group signed off on a budget of $176.4 million for Project Drueth. The renewal with Casionix Partners closes at $142.5 million a year, 8.3 percent below the last contract. Project Fraax slips by six weeks because of the tooling delay.

## Releases

Hey support folks — quick notes on ProfileMesh shard releases. Each release re-balances user-profile shards gradually, so don't panic if a lookup lands on a stale shard for a few minutes post-deploy; it self-heals. Release bundles are published twice a month and are always signed. If a customer asks you to verify a bundle they downloaded, walk them through the checksum step using the public signing key below.

deploy key for kawif-bageg: bky19_YQNdHDgpaLxUNwPoHm9

## PickWise Runbook — Support Quick Reference

If a warehouse reports weird pick sequences (backtracking, skipped aisles), PickWise is probably running with stale zone maps. First ask which site it is — Thornfield and Copperhollow have different aisle layouts and separate configs. A restart reloads the maps, so that's usually the fix. Before restarting, double-check the node is running with the expected settings, which should match the following.

deployment values, fahap-hahaf:
[casdor]
port = 9200
region = south-2
host = casdor.qirvanworks.corp
timeout_ms = 3000
retries = 4

// Setup for the Fairledge rate-parity checker client.
// New folks: this service compares our published hotel rates against
// partner channels via the internal Ratescope aggregator. Mismatches
// beyond 1.5% get flagged to the pricing queue automatically, so don't
// panic if you see alerts during testing — use the sandbox tenant.
// The client authenticates to Ratescope with the key on the next line.

service key, tadup-tahog: zpat7_wB1tnEL